DIRI PRESENTS N998.3BN BAYELSA 2026 BUDGET TO ASSEMBLY

By: Safiya Abdulrahim Dabban

Governor Douye Diri has submitted the N998.3 billion Bayelsa 2026 Appropriation Bill, tagged “Budget of Assured Prosperity II,” to the State House of Assembly. He said the budget aims to boost infrastructure, improve services, and enhance the quality of life for residents.

The proposed budget is nearly N300 billion higher than that of 2025. It allocates 64.6% to capital projects and 35.4% to recurrent spending, with strong focus on ongoing works, education, health, sports, water supply, power, and agriculture.

Governor Diri urged lawmakers to ensure speedy passage. Speaker Abraham Ingobere pledged the Assembly’s support and commended the administration’s development drive.
